Package: qa.debian.org
Severity: wishlist
Currently, all symlinks shipped as part of source packages are forbidden
and cannot be accessed for security reasons. Debsources should be more
clever about that, and allow access to symlinks that point with the same
package/version.

Package: sloccount
Version: 2.26-5.1
Severity: normal
Tags: upstream
sloccount seems to be unaware of the Scala programming language and its
source files, which usually match the *.scala glob pattern. It would
be nice to have that fixed.
Many thanks for maintaining sloccount in Debian!

Package: pound
Version: 2.6-2
Severity: minor
File: /usr/share/doc/pound/FAQ.gz
Heya,
FAQ entry 4.2 about virtual hosting with HTTPS has been obsoleted by SNI
support addition in pound. It would be nice to amend it, so that people with
virtual hosting / SSL needs are not driven away from pound.
